The Sunday Times: Israel plans to separate Gaza into three civilian areas surrounded by four military areas

The Sunday Times revealed a leaked document showing an Israeli plan to force civilians in Gaza to live in three narrow and besieged areas, separated by four Israeli military areas in the north, central and southern Gaza Strip, in the event of a failure to reach a ceasefire agreement with Hamas.

Strict restrictions on the movement of civilians

According to the plan, the mobility between the three civilian areas will be prohibited without a permit, with strict inspection procedures that include identification verification through pictures or codes of Barcode. Humanitarian organizations, informed of the plan, indicate that this system may lead to the separation of the population from their lands and homes.

A new military operation called “Gideon Vehicles”

At the same time, Israel announced the launch of a new military operation under the name “Gideon Vehicles” with the aim of full control of the Gaza Strip, and during the last days it launched air strikes that killed more than 250 people, according to the Ministry of Health and Civil Defense of Gaza.

Huge military infrastructure

The plan called “the third stage: full control of Gaza” includes the establishment of a new military corridor between the south and central Gaza Strip, which is based on the ruins of residential areas, and it extends narrowly compared to the former “Netsarim” corridor, with the expansion of a military zone in the north to make way for the army’s movements.

Long -term plan to control Gaza

The first stage of the implementation of the plan is expected to take about three weeks, and it includes the introduction of the new corridors in the center and the expansion of the security belt in the north. The map also shows 12 potential points for the distribution of humanitarian aid, which will be managed by private companies under the supervision of the Israeli army, amid widespread criticism of this privatization.

Close the crossings and use aid as a pressure card

Israel had closed the crossings in front of the entry of aid since March 2, under the pretext of pressure on Hamas to release the hostages, accusing the movement of seizing aid that enters through global relief organizations.

The continuation of calm negotiations and international calls for fire

A new round of calm negotiations is currently being held in Doha, according to Hamas official, Taher Al -Nono, without preconditions. At an Arab summit in Baghdad, the Arab leaders and the international community called for immediate intervention to stop the war and ensure the arrival of aid.

Nations warnings of the humanitarian catastrophe

The Secretary -General of the United Nations Antonio Guterres described the situation in Gaza as “beyond description, inhumane”, stressing that “the blockade and starvation mocks international law,” calling for a permanent ceasefire.
